Professor Jiasheng Wang from University of Georgia visited our School as an oversea lecturer from May 19 to June 2, and gave a series of lectures on food toxicology for both of graduate students and undergraduate students.

At June 1st, he gave an academic lecture with the title of ‘Modulation of Toxic Effects and Human Disease Risks with Active Food Components and Natural Products’ in the classroom 503 of Building No.34. More than 100 teachers and students attended this lecture. The meeting was hosted by Professor Li Li.

During the presentation, Professor Wang gave an introduction on his research interests, which including food safety and toxic effects of foodborne toxicants, chemical carcinogenesis and chronic diseases prevention. Professor Wang shared his novel searches of tea polyphenols and lycopene.
